"Adorable book for the new reader who loves Texas!"T is for Texastakes you on a journey across the Lone Star state through dazzling photos and fun, informative couplets written by kids, for kids. Learn about the people, plants, and animals that call Texas home with features for every letter of the alphabet. Its so much fun, young readers will want to explore T is for Texas again and again! This book covers subjects important or significant to Texans and includes brilliant color photography by top photographers. Each vibrant page highlights a unique aspect of Texas's beauty and lively culture.The books eye-popping design and educational content will hold childrens interests through countless readings. In addition to the 26 letters of the alphabet is the Who Knew?Facts about the great state of Texas section which gives parents, teachers, and kids a deeper understanding of what makes Texas unique.Add T is for Texas to your library and explore even more with the entire See My State series!

This book is aimed at children in preschool-3rd grade.

This book has been graded for interest at 4-8 years.

There are 32 pages in this book. This book was published in 2019 by Graphic Arts Books .

Written by children participating in Boys & Girls Clubs of Greater Fort Worth. A donation will be made to the organization, and each contributing child is credited in the book for their work.
